Sharing Warmth at Yeosu Coastal Passenger Terminal


Yeosu Coastal Passenger Terminal operates regular routes connecting Geomundo, Yeondo, Hamgumi, and Dunbyeong Island. According to the Yeosu Regional Office of Oceans and Fisheries, approximately 20,000 travelers were expected to use the terminal during the Lunar New Year period.


With increased passenger flow, emergency safety personnel were positioned throughout the facility. In the midst of that movement, volunteers wearing traditional hanbok approached citizens carefully and offered New Year greetings.


Along with the words, “Happy New Year,” they distributed small fortune pouch air fresheners and hand warmers printed with promotional messages for the 2026 Yeosu World Island Expo.

Continued Campaigns Since 2024


The Shincheonji Volunteer Group Yeosu Branch has carried out promotional campaigns and environmental cleanup activities in support of the 2026 Yeosu World Island Expo since 2024.


The expo is scheduled to take place from September 5 to November 4, 2026, at the main venue in Jimo District of Dolsan and sub-venues on Gaedo and Geumodo. Around 30 island-holding countries are expected to participate, highlighting ecological, historical, and cultural values of islands.
